Discover Partenstein in Germany

Partenstein in the region of Bavaria with its 2,844 habitants is a town located in Germany - some 240 mi or ( 386 km ) South-West of Berlin , the country's capital .

Langenprozelten Pumped Storage Station

The Langenprozelten Pumped Storage Station is a pumped storage power power station near Gemünden am Main at the Main in the under-Frankish district Main Spessart, which went in service in 1976. The hydro-electric power plant has an output of 180 MW. It uses two Francis turbines. The upper reservoir is nearly 300 meters higher than the lower reservoir and is connected with ist by one for about 1.3 km long pipes. The maximum head is 320 m.
